Calculate the pH gradient across the inner mitochondrial membrane that is necessary to drive the ATPase reaction in the direction of ATP synthesis under steady state conditions at 25°C where
ATP=10^-5 M
ADP= 10^-3 M
Pi=2 x 10^-2 M
Also- do not ignore the effect of the membrane potential!
